De La Hoya is still in his prime. This fight is like De La Hoya and Hopkins though. With Mayweather as the De La Hoya and De La Hoya as the Hopkins.Remember that Mayweather is going up in weight. De La Hoya naturaly is way bigger and stronger then Mayweather. And he is fast enough to hit him with his best punches. Mayweather has never fought anybody like that before. And Sugar Shane Mosely is Oscars chief sparring partner. That is a huge advatage because Sugar shane is every bit as fast as mayweather and he has the excact same style for oscar to learn.
